
Presenting the report explaining, receiving feedback, and revising the draft Law, Minister of Agriculture and Environment Tran Duc Thang stated that in recent times, a number of obstacles, bottlenecks, and bottlenecks have arisen that need to be addressed immediately to promptly resolve them in order to promote socio-economic development and improve the effectiveness and efficiency of agricultural and environmental management. Focusing on removing legal "bottlenecks" and "bottlenecks" arising from practice; promptly proposing solutions to emerging problems and inadequacies, especially those related to economic development, particularly aiming for an 8% growth target in 2025 and "double-digit" growth in the future, coupled with addressing issues related to the restructuring and organization of the two-tiered local government apparatus, is the objective of developing the draft Law.
In response to the opinion that the scope of the Law is quite broad, it is suggested that consideration be given to applying Resolution No. 206/2025/QH15 of the National Assembly on special mechanisms for handling difficulties and obstacles arising from legal provisions, allowing the Government to issue resolutions to address difficulties and obstacles caused by legal provisions instead of amending or supplementing the Law. Regarding this matter, the Government reports and clarifies as follows: The draft Law amends and supplements 15 laws, but the content of the amendments and supplements to these 15 laws focuses on adjusting and confining itself to three main groups of issues (organizational restructuring; administrative procedure reform, investment and business conditions; bottlenecks), primarily focusing on organizational restructuring while simultaneously addressing 20 already established bottlenecks in 9 laws to ensure immediate resolution in 2025. Separating the handling of these 20 bottlenecks to be implemented according to Resolution No. 206/2025/QH15 would result in 9 separate resolutions on bottleneck resolution, which is inappropriate.

Regarding the application of the mechanism in Resolution No. 206/2025/QH15, the drafting agency has identified two laws with obstacles that need to be addressed and has submitted to the Government two Resolutions to resolve the obstacles caused by legal regulations in the fields of agriculture and environment as stipulated in Resolution No. 206/2025/QH15, including: Government Resolution No. 66.3/2025/NQ-CP on resolving and handling obstacles to implement projects during the period when the National Land Use Planning for the period 2021 - 2030, with a vision to 2050, has not yet been approved for adjustment; Government Resolution No. 66.4/2025/NQ-CP promulgates specific mechanisms and policies to address difficulties in the implementation of the 2024 Law on Geology and Minerals. Furthermore, the handling of obstacles and bottlenecks in the draft Law amending and supplementing 15 laws is carried out through the issuance of legal normative documents as stipulated in point b, clause 1, Article of Resolution No. 206/2025/QH15.
